Deep Learning–Based Prediction of Glaucoma Severity and Progression Using Imo/TEMPO Screening Program
Purpose: To develop DeepISP, a deep learning model that predicts the comprehensive visual field (VF) information of the Humphrey visual field analyzer (HFA) based on rapid screening perimetry (Imo/TEMPO screening program [ISP]).
